> Central Filling and Packing Sections

The King Institute of Preventive Medicine?
  • This department carries out the Containerization of all vaccines manufactured at KIPM. Vaccines are received in bulk sterile containers from the manufacturing department for distribution in vials of 5, 10, 15, 20, 30 ml using automatic filling and vial capping machines under strict aseptic condition as per the GMP.

  • The containerized vaccines are stored in the 'cold room' at 2? to 8? Celsius until they are certified for release by the Biological control department.? The vaccines are supplied to the Tamil Nadu Medical Services corporation for distribution to all hospitals, PHCs and dispensaries.

  • In addition, pyrogen - free distilled water and standard de-ionized water are being manufactured from the multicolumn distilled water plant and distributed to various departments for the manufacture of vaccines and sera.
